Abstract:
A widely applied dose-response model is the Hill model with four parameters. In the Hill model, the measurement error may be homoscedastic or heteroscedastic. If the experimental points are fixed with the goal of identifying the right error-variance structure, then by applying the KL-criterion, we have that only two different doses are necessary. Hence, this optimum design does not enable any estimation of the parameters. From here the necessity to add some other experimental points. This work focuses on augmenting the KL-optimal design by the inclusion of two additional doses with the goal of providing an estimation of the model parameters, while guaranteeing a minimum KL-efficiency to optimally discriminate between the two variance structures.
